...
首页> 外文期刊>Autonomous agents and multi-agent systems >Dynamic service composition enabled by introspective agent coordination
【24h】

Dynamic service composition enabled by introspective agent coordination

机译:通过内省的座席协调实现动态服务组合

获取原文
获取原文并翻译 | 示例
           

摘要

Service composition has received much interest from many research communities. The major research efforts published to date propose the use of service orchestration to model this problem. However, the designed orchestration approaches are static since they follow a predefined plan specifying the services to be composed and their data flow, and most of them are centralized around a composition engine. Further, task decomposition is made prior to service composition, whereas it should be performed according to the available competencies. In order to overcome these limitations, we propose to model a dynamic approach for service composition. The studied approach relies on the decentralized and autonomous collaboration of a set of services whose aim is to achieve a specific goal. In our work, this goal is to satisfy requirements in software services that are freely expressed by human users (i.e. not predefined through a composition plan). We propose to enable the service collaborations through a multi-agent coordination protocol. In our model, agents offer services and are endowed with introspective capabilities, that is, they can access and reason on their state and actions at runtime. Thereby, the agents are capable of decomposing a monolithic task according to their service skills, and dynamically coordinating with their acquaintances to cover the whole task achievement. This paper presents the adaptive agent-based approach we propose for dynamic service composition, describes its architecture, specifies the underlying coordination protocol, called Composer, verifies the protocol's main properties, and validates it by unfolding an implemented scenario.
机译:服务组合已引起许多研究社区的浓厚兴趣。迄今为止已发表的主要研究成果提出了使用服务编排对该问题进行建模的方法。但是,设计的编排方法是静态的,因为它们遵循预定义的计划,该计划指定了要组合的服务及其数据流,并且大多数围绕组合引擎进行集中。此外,任务分解是在服务组合之前进行的,而应根据可用能力来执行。为了克服这些限制,我们建议对服务组合的动态方法进行建模。研究的方法依赖于一组服务的分散和自主协作,这些服务的目的是实现特定的目标。在我们的工作中,这个目标是要满足人类用户自由表达的软件服务要求(即未通过撰写计划预先定义)。我们建议通过多代理协调协议启用服务协作。在我们的模型中,代理提供服务并具有自省功能,也就是说,他们可以在运行时访问状态和操作并对其进行推理。因此,代理能够根据他们的服务技能分解整体任务,并能够动态地与他们的熟人协调以覆盖整个任务的完成。本文介绍了我们为动态服务组合提出的基于自适应代理的方法,描述了其体系结构,指定了称为Composer的基础协调协议,验证了协议的主要属性,并通过展开已实现的场景对其进行了验证。

著录项

相似文献

  • 外文文献
  • 中文文献
  • 专利
获取原文

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号